Offline | A new Continuously Variable Valve Actuation system At www.pattakon.com a new Continuously Variable Valve Actuation system is presented, with working prototype photos, plots and animations (even STEREOSCOPIC ones). Any engine, racing or normal, can be improved as the torque can be about constant from very low revs to the top allowable revs of the engine. Comments? Objections? |
